系统定义别名
常见的 Java 类型内建的相应的类型别名
别名 | 映射的类型 |
---|---|
_byte | byte |
_long | long |
_short | short |
_int | int |
_integer | int |
_double | double |
_float | float |
_boolean | boolean |
string | String |
byte | Byte |
long | Long |
short | Short |
int | Integer |
integer | Integer |
double | Double |
float | Float |
boolean | Boolean |
date | Date |
decimal | BigDecimal |
bigdecimal | BigDecimal |
object | Object |
map | Map |
hashmap | HashMap |
list | List |
arraylist | ArrayList |
collection | Collection |
iterator | Iterator |
自定义别名
具体某一个java类
<typeAliases>
<typeAlias type="priv.dengjl.ns.bean.TestOracle" alias="TestOracle"/>
</typeAliases>
包
<typeAliases>
<package name="priv.dengjl.ns.bean"/>
</typeAliases>
别名重复
使用更高的优先级方式区分,@Alias(“TestOracle2”)